Scholastic Book Fairs are wondrous in-person experiences that empower kids to discover books for themselves. Taking place in schools and rooted in Scholastic’s greater mission to use the power of books for the betterment of all kids, Fairs bring entire communities together.
At Scholastic Book Fairs, we bring “the best school day of the year” in 110,000 unique pop-up shops annually. Irresistibly defying expectations of how one must act in a library, Fairs raise over 200 million dollars in funds and resources for schools that host Fairs. And we’re just getting started…
We’re here to deliver an experience that inspires kids toward greatness. In everything we do, we are committed to ensuring every kid, parent, caregiver, teen/tween, book fair organizer, and Employee feels seen, respected, and welcome as part of the Scholastic Book Fairs family.
We are currently in search of New Business Sales Representatives to help secure new opportunities and grow the Book Fair business. These full-time positions offer medical, dental and vision benefits, a Paid Time Off program that includes vacation, personal and sick time, a generous 50% off discount on Scholastic merchandise, 401k with a company match, and the possibility of summers off.
In additions to the base rate, Scholastic offers a Sales Compensation program which includes the opportunity to earn annual incentives. This Net Revenue Bonus enables participants to earn 1.5% of all Net Revenue booked from their assigned prospects. Earned bonuses are paid annually and do not have a maximum earnings cap.

PRIMARY OBJECTIVES
Prospecting: Research and identify potential school and district partners. Initiate outbound calls, emails, and social media outreach to decision-makers such as Principals, PTS Leaders and School Administrators.
Lead Qualifications: Qualify prospects by understanding their needs, timelines, and interests in hosting Book Fairs. Set up appointments and pass along qualified leads to Account Managers.
Relationship Building: Establish rapport with educators and administrators, emphasizing the value of Scholastic Reading Events in promoting literacy and supporting school communities.
Pipeline Management: Maintain accurate and up-to-date records of interactions in the CRM system. Track progress toward monthly and quarterly goals.
Collaboration and Strategy: Work closely with the sales team to align outreach strategies and improve lead generation efficiency. Continuously learning and refining sales techniques, product knowledge, and industry insights, including staying informed about industry trends, customer preferences and emerging opportunities to enhance effectiveness and achieve targets.
